ABBV vs JNJ: by the numbers

  • JNJ is the larger company ($642.79B vs $465.51B market cap).
  • JNJ tr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(30.82 vs 125.98 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
  • JNJ converts more revenue to profit (21.48% vs 5.79% net margin).
  • ABBV grew revenue faster over the past five years (4.59% vs 2.93% CAGR).
  • ABBV pays the higher dividend yield (2.62% vs 1.97%).

Frequently asked

Which has the lower trailing P/E, ABBV or JNJ?
JNJ has the lower trailing P/E: ABBV trades at 125.98 and JNJ at 30.82. P/E is one valuation measure and does not by itself establish which business is cheaper.
Which has grown faster, ABBV or JNJ?
Over the past five years, ABBV grew revenue faster — ABBV at a 4.59% CAGR versus JNJ at 2.93%.
Does ABBV or JNJ pay a bigger dividend?
ABBV yields 2.62% and JNJ yields 1.97% based on trailing dividends and the latest price.
Is ABBV or JNJ more profitable?
JNJ runs the higher net margin — ABBV at 5.79% versus JNJ at 21.48%.
How have ABBV and JNJ total returns compared?
Over the past 10 years, ABBV delivered 19.57% and JNJ delivered 10.85% annualized total return. Past performance doesn't predict future results.
